Quick answer: how much does Audiomack pay per stream?

Audiomack pays approximately $0.001–$0.002 per stream on average. That works out to roughly $7–$10 per 5,000 streams, though this figure varies significantly by region, ad market conditions, and whether listeners are on free or premium plans. There is no fixed flat rate.

Keep in mind: Audiomack does not publicly disclose a flat per-stream rate. These figures are derived from artist-reported earnings and industry estimates. Your actual payout depends on your audience’s geography, how much revenue the platform generated that month, and how many other monetized streams were served.


How Audiomack’s payment system works

Audiomack pays artists through the Audiomack Monetization Program (AMP), launched in 2021 and now available globally. Here’s the core mechanic behind every payout:

1

Revenue pooling. Audiomack collects money from two sources: ad revenue (from free-tier listeners) and subscription fees from Audiomack+ premium subscribers.

2

Revenue per stream is calculated monthly. At the end of each month, Audiomack divides total platform revenue by total platform streams to get a “revenue per stream” figure. This number changes every month.

3

50% goes to artists. AMP creators receive 50% of the revenue per stream, multiplied by the number of streams their monetized content generated that month.

4

Geography matters. Streams from the US, UK, and Canada generate more revenue than streams from lower-CPM markets, because advertisers pay more to reach those audiences.

5

Payouts are processed quarterly, typically with a 2–4 month delay from when streams are earned.

⚠️ No flat rate: Unlike Spotify’s rough $0.003–$0.005 benchmark, Audiomack’s “revenue per stream” is a floating variable. You’ll only know your exact rate once the month closes and payouts are calculated.

The Supporters feature

Beyond ad-based streaming, Audiomack also offers a Supporters feature where fans can pay a monthly subscription directly to a specific artist. Audiomack passes on around 85% of those contributions to the creator, significantly better margins than streaming royalties and an important secondary income channel for dedicated fanbases.

Audiomack vs other streaming platforms: pay per stream

Audiomack’s per-stream rate is lower than most major platforms, but that’s not the whole story — it offers something the others don’t: direct upload without a distributor, and a fast-growing African and hip-hop audience.

PlatformEst. per stream (2025–26)Per 1,000 streamsArtist-friendly?
TIDAL$0.012–$0.015$12–$15High
Apple Music$0.007–$0.010$7–$10High
Amazon Music$0.004–$0.008$4–$8Medium-High
Deezer$0.0064$6.40Medium
YouTube Music$0.005–$0.007$5–$7Medium
Spotify$0.003–$0.005$3–$5Medium
Audiomack$0.001–$0.002$1–$2Free uploads
YouTube Content ID~$0.00087$0.87Low

The real value of Audiomack isn’t the per-stream rate — it’s the discoverability. Audiomack has over 100 million monthly users, no gatekeeper, and is the dominant platform for Afrobeats, Afropop, and hip-hop. For artists building an audience in Africa and its diaspora, Audiomack streams often convert into real fans faster than Spotify placements do.


How to qualify for Audiomack AMP

You can’t earn streaming royalties on Audiomack until you’re approved for the Audiomack Monetization Program. Here are the requirements:

🔒
Verified / authenticated profile
Your account must be authenticated through the Audiomack dashboard before applying.
👥
Minimum 100 followers
Build at least 100 followers on your Audiomack account before submitting an AMP application.
▶️
50,000 plays in 6 months
Your music must accumulate at least 50,000 organic plays within any rolling 6-month window.
🎵
Original content only
Only original music qualifies. DJ mixes or covers with unlicensed samples may be rejected.

💡 Audiomack Pro shortcut: Audiomack announced Pro in late 2025, which gives subscribers immediate AMP access without waiting to hit the 50,000-play threshold — useful for artists who want to start earning right away.

Common reasons AMP applications are denied

Applications are frequently denied for: copyright-infringing content (unlicensed samples, DJ mixes), suspicious or artificial stream traffic, incomplete profile verification, or not meeting the follower and play thresholds.


How to maximize your Audiomack earnings

📤
Upload consistently
Regular uploads increase your chances of landing on trending and discovery playlists, driving organic streams.
🌍
Target US/UK/Canada audiences
Streams from high-CPM markets pay 2–3× more than low-CPM regions. Promoting to diaspora audiences pays off.
❤️
Activate Supporters
The Supporters feature pays up to 85% revenue share — far above the 50% streaming rate. Even 50 supporters can outperform thousands of streams.
📈
Aim for trending charts
Chart placements on Audiomack’s trending pages generate massive organic discovery, especially for Afrobeats and hip-hop.
🔗
Cross-promote everywhere
Share Audiomack links on TikTok, Instagram Reels, and Twitter/X. Embeds play natively and count as streams.
📊
Use AMP analytics
The AMP dashboard shows which tracks earn most. Double down on formats that produce higher stream counts.

Frequently asked questions

Does Audiomack pay artists for free streams?
Yes. Audiomack generates ad revenue from free-tier listeners and distributes 50% of that revenue to AMP-enrolled artists. Premium (Audiomack+) streams tend to generate more per play since subscription fees are higher than ad CPMs.
How long does Audiomack take to pay out?
Audiomack processes payouts quarterly, typically with a 2–4 month delay. Streams earned in January may be paid around late April. You can track pending earnings inside the AMP dashboard.
What is the minimum payout threshold?
The minimum payout threshold is $10. Your earnings will accumulate until you reach this amount before a withdrawal can be processed.
Is AMP available in Africa and other countries outside the US?
Yes. AMP is globally available. Audiomack expanded the program worldwide so artists in Nigeria, Ghana, South Africa, and other markets can all apply and earn.
Can I earn money on Audiomack without AMP?
You won’t earn streaming royalties without AMP, but you can still use the Supporters feature and drive traffic from Audiomack to other monetized platforms.
Why do some artists report higher rates than others?
Because the rate is variable. Artists with more US/UK/Canada listeners, streams during high-ad-spend months (like Q4), or a larger share of total platform streams will see higher per-stream figures than artists whose audience is in low-CPM markets.
